Kirkland Advises KKR on a Renewables Portfolio Joint Venture with TotalEnergies

Kirkland & Ellis advised KKR on an agreement whereby insurance vehicles and accounts managed by KKR will acquire 50% of a 1.4 GW solar portfolio in North America from TotalEnergies. This transaction values the portfolio at an enterprise value of $1.25 billion and covers six utility-scale solar assets with a combined capacity of 1.3 GW, and 41 distributed generation assets totaling 140 MW, primarily situated in the U.S. TotalEnergies will keep a 50% stake in the assets and continue to operate them after the closing of this transaction, which is subject to customary conditions.
